软网卡是一种网络芯片,属于电子产品类别。与硬网卡不同,软网卡仅包含PHY模块,而
数据链路层(
MAC)控制器通常集成于南桥芯片组内,需配合使用。该架构多见于主板设计中,例如nVIDIA芯片组采用VITESSE VSC8601或Realtek RTL8201CL作为PHY芯片,VIA芯片组多搭载VT6103型号。软网卡的驱动实际作用于集成在芯片组内的MAC控制器,PHY芯片本身无需独立驱动,设备管理器内显示的网卡设备即为MAC控制器。典型软网卡芯片包括Realtek RTL8201CL、Marvell 88E1116、VIA VT6103L及VITESSE VSC8201RX等。与之对应的硬网卡则整合MAC与PHY功能,代表型号有Realtek RTL8111系列、Marvell 88E8053和VIA VT6105。
物理层由两部分组成,即PHY(Physical Layer,物理层)和传输器。常见的
网卡芯片都是把MAC和PHY集成在一个芯片中,但目前很多主板的
南桥芯片已包含了以太网MAC控制功能,只是未提供
物理层接口,因此,需外接PHY芯片以提供以太网的接入通道。这类PHY网络芯片就是俗称的“软
网卡芯片”,常见的PHY功能的芯片有RTL8201BL、VT6103等等。